🍵 Pineapple Peel Golden Tea Recipe

🧾 Ingredients

  • Peels from 1 thoroughly washed pineapple
  • 10–15 whole cloves
  • 6–8 cups filtered water
  • Optional: 1 cinnamon stick

👩‍🍳 Instructions

1. Wash the Pineapple Carefully

Because the peel will be used, proper cleaning is important.

Before peeling:

  • Soak the pineapple in water with:
    • 1 tablespoon baking soda
    • A splash of white vinegar

Allow it to sit for about 10 minutes, then gently scrub the surface.


2. Prepare the Pot

  • Place the pineapple peels into a large pot.
  • Add the cloves.
  • Pour in enough water to fully cover the peels.

Bring the mixture to a gentle boil.


3. Simmer Slowly

Reduce the heat and simmer for approximately:

⏱️ 20–25 minutes with the lid partially covered.


4. Let It Infuse

Turn off the heat and allow the tea to cool naturally for a few minutes.

This helps the flavors and aromas develop more fully.


5. Strain and Store

Strain the golden liquid into:

  • A glass bottle
  • Or an airtight glass container

Storage Tip

Store in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

⚠️ When to Avoid Drinking It

It's generally best not to drink this tea immediately before bedtime.

Why?

Because:

  • Pineapple naturally contains acids
  • Cloves may stimulate digestion
  • Warm beverages close to bedtime may increase nighttime bathroom trips

Some individuals may experience:

  • Occasional acid reflux
  • Mild digestive discomfort
  • Interrupted sleep

Helpful Tip

Try enjoying your final cup at least 2 hours before bedtime.
